Some of the activated sludge is returned to your aeration tank to boost the populace of aerobic bacteria and speed up the cleansing of watery waste. The digester tank gets the remaining activated sludge. The water in the next sedimentation tank consists of very little natural and organic content and suspended matter.

Beneath these oxygenated ailments, microorganisms prosper, forming an active, healthy suspension of biological solids—largely germs—identified as activated sludge. About 6 hrs of detention is presented inside the aeration tank. This gives the microbes more than enough time to soak up dissolved organics with the sewage, lowering the BOD. The mixture then flows with the aeration tank in the secondary clarifier, exactly where activated sludge settles out by gravity. Clear water is skimmed within the floor from the clarifier, disinfected, and discharged as secondary effluent.
